A+ Stability but Disappointing Wash
by
spirrotta
,
Sep 27, 2006
|
|||||||||||
|
Pros: VERY stable operation even with pedestal on Upper Floor
Cons: Minimal Features, Lousy Stain Fighting, Mediocre Clean
The Bottom Line: Recommended for upper floor laundry room installs. Not recommended for cleaning stained clothes (such as children's clothes).
Review: We bought the Duet Sport Washer and Dryer in April because it seemed to be the only front-load model on the market that was recommended for Second Floor install. True to the marketing, it is extremely stable in our 1840 Colonial installed on the Second ...
